TrustCSI™ Security Assessment Services POC Offer

1.
The offer is valid until 30 Sep, 2026 on a first-come, first-served basis.
2. The offer applies to NEW TrustCSI™ Security Assessment Services customers and is limited to 5 qualified organizations located in Hong Kong, as determined by CITIC Telecom CPC at its sole discretion. Each organization is eligible for the offer once only.
3. Organizations that select the “TrustCSI™ Security Assessment POC Offer” are NOT eligible for the “AI SOC Services POC Offer”.
4.
One-time black-box vulnerability scanning service applied to selected website with a single URL, when followed up with one-time black-box penetration test service applied to this same URL.
5. OR One-time black-box vulnerability scanning service applied to infrastructures with a maximum of 50 hosts (up to two different host types), followed up with one-time black-box penetration test service applied to two selected hosts from these hosts.
6.
Conducting analysis of the above findings.
7.
Provide assessment findings in report.
8.
All services are conducted within Hong Kong on a one-off basis.
9. Services provided in office hours.
10. CITIC Telecom CPC's office hours are from 09:00 AM to 06:00 PM, Monday to Friday but excluding public holidays specified by Government of Hong Kong and any adverse circumstances evaluated by CITIC Telecom CPC (as determined in the sole opinion of CITIC Telecom CPC).
11.
All works will be performed from remote by default.
12.
CITIC Telecom CPC reserves the right to use any tools available to fulfil the service.
13.
Only known vulnerabilities with known exploits will be attempted.
14.
Denial of service and intrusive scanning are not performed.
